Want clarity on your gymnast's injury? Attending doctor visits with parents and asking questions can help. Crucially, always get modifications in writing from doctors or physical therapists to understand what the athlete is cleared to do. This documentation is essential for their care and legal protection.

🔥 Can’t get your splits? READ THIS 👇

🚨NOTE: there was NO PAIN and “Streatching became FUN!” for this athlete

If you’re just sitting in a split hoping it’ll magically gets better… that’s the problem 😅

You don’t need more stretching.
You need more CONTROL. 💪

Try these 4 game-changers:

1️⃣ Dynamic Mobility with Massager- The vibration from a massager distracts the nerves into feeling safe allowing for more flexibility
2️⃣ Neural Dynamic Kneeling Split Mobility – Sliding and gliding the nerves putting tension on and off the neural system improves oxygen to the nerves and improves neural mobility. Move to the point of tension/mild discomfort.
3️⃣ Split Nerve Glides – Hands on blocks/panels. Square hip splits. Stop at the point of tension in the front or back leg. Move the head and toes just to the point feel tension/ mild discomfort.

“ Head down - Toes down” “Head up - Toes up”
4️⃣ Supported Straddle Weight Shifts + Frog Squats – In standing straddle bend forward to point of tension (if tight this may need yoga blocks or panel mat for hands) shift wight from side to side to point of tension. Frog squats curl head in with straight legs and look up to ceiling with bent from legs both to point of tension.

KEY TO DYNAMIC NEURAL MOBILITY is to:

1. Be gentle, allow go to the point of tension/ mild discomfort
2. Find your natural rhythm with movement
3. Breathe with the movement
4. 2-3 Sets of 20 or so reps
5. LESS is MORE!

✨ Flexibility isn’t about forcing the range.
✨ It’s about creating neural safety to allow for freeing the bodies neural tension.

A mechanical issue left unaddressed only worsens over time. Simply waiting for growth plates to close won't fix the underlying problem. It's crucial to ask 'What caused this?' to break the cycle of pain and prevent it from resurfacing elsewhere like the hips, knees, or ankles.
